Comparison of in vivo and in vitro Dry Matter Digestibility of Mule Deer Forages
Urness PJ, Smith AD, Watkins RK. 1977. Comparison of in vivo and in vitro Dry Matter Digestibility of Mule Deer Forages. Journal of Range Management. 30(2):119-121
In vivo digestibility percentages from mule deer (Odocoileus hemionus) digestion-balance trials were usually higher than in vitro determinations obtained from the same experimental forage species. Linear regression analysis suggested a correction factor could be applied to in vitro estimates to make them more nearly correspond to in vivo dry matter digestibility values. Forages with in vitro digestibility values below 35% often varied markedly from in vivo estimates. It raises the question whether deer consume species lower than this in digestibility given reasonable choice.
